{"product_id":"night-258217","title":"Night","description":"Born into a Jewish ghetto in Hungary, as a child, Elie Wiesel was sent to the Nazi concentration camps at Auschwitz and Buchenwald. This is his account of that atrocity: the ever-increasing horrors he endured, the loss of his family and his struggle to survive in a world that stripped him of humanity, dignity and faith. Describing in simple terms the tragic murder of a people from a survivor's perspective, Night is among the most personal, intimate and poignant of all accounts of the Holocaust. A compelling consideration of the darkest side of human nature and the enduring power of hope, it remains one of the most important works of the twentieth century.","brand":"Koorong","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":51560928018719,"sku":"9780140189896","price":22.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0925\/8981\/8143\/files\/9780140189896_477617.jpg?v=1769125623","url":"https:\/\/koorong.com\/products\/night-258217","provider":"Koorong","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
